The advent of the Internet of Things (IoT) has reworked quite a few sectors by enhancing connectivity between devices, providing myriad alternatives for knowledge exchange and automation. Despite its potential, IoT connectivity points in rural areas pose important challenges. As technology rapidly advances, many rural communities battle to entry enough web service, hampering their capacity to leverage IoT options absolutely.


In rural locales, the shortage of dependable broadband infrastructure is a major factor contributing to IoT connectivity points. Traditional telecommunication firms usually focus their investments in urban areas where demand and potential profitability are greater. This neglect leaves vast rural landscapes underserved, making it troublesome for IoT devices to function effectively - Access Control Iot Devices. Without stable web, smart sensors and related units can't relay data to central techniques, resulting in inefficiencies.




Moreover, geographic isolation exacerbates connectivity challenges. Many rural areas are characterized by rugged terrain and distance from communication hubs. Physical obstacles can impede the set up of essential infrastructure, resulting in poor sign quality and restricted access to high-speed internet connections. These points can be especially pronounced throughout adverse climate situations, further destabilizing connectivity.


Latency is another important issue impacting IoT deployment in rural areas. Low latency is significant for so much of IoT functions, particularly those requiring real-time knowledge processing and decision-making, such as agricultural monitoring or healthcare companies. In rural settings devoid of standard broadband access, delays in transmitting information turn out to be extra pronounced, hampering the effectiveness of those applications. Residents may discover it more and more challenging to depend upon IoT technologies as a outcome of lag in responsiveness.

The numerous environmental circumstances current extra issues. For occasion, rural areas often struggle with fluctuating network performance. Factors similar to bodily obstructions, atmospheric circumstances, and long-distance sign transmission can cut back the effectivity of connectivity. These variables can result in disruptions, making IoT technologies much less dependable and fewer interesting for customers attempting to undertake new options.


Deployment prices are one other hurdle in rural IoT implementation. Establishing needed infrastructure requires considerable investment, which can be difficult to justify in sparsely populated areas with lower income levels. Remote sensors, smart devices, gateways, and other technologies may be possible in city settings but lack economies of scale in rural regions, posing a financial challenge for both service suppliers and customers.

In addition, the absence of competitive markets can hinder progress. Urban areas often benefit from multiple web service suppliers competing for patrons, leading to higher service quality and innovation. Conversely, rural communities may have limited choices, leading to monopolistic practices that can stifle improvement in connectivity options. The lack of competitors prevents users from accessing more inexpensive and dependable services, further isolating them from technological developments.


Another concern revolves around security. IoT gadgets, when poorly related, can become vulnerable to cyberattacks. Inadequate connectivity can lead to outdated firmware and software program, which may not receive well timed updates. This state of affairs increases the chance of breaches, leaving sensitive data uncovered to malicious actors. Users may hesitate to undertake IoT technologies, fearing repercussions from insufficient cybersecurity measures.


Education plays a vital position in addressing IoT connectivity issues in rural areas. Communities want adequate knowledge about the advantages of IoT technologies to drive demand for better connectivity options. By understanding how these technologies can improve agriculture, healthcare, logistics, and the day by day lives of residents, communities might advocate for improved infrastructure and services. Increased consciousness may prompt both government and personal sector initiatives to put money into rural connectivity.


Government insurance policies can significantly have an result on the landscape of IoT connectivity in rural areas. Governments can incentivize telecommunication providers to broaden their networks by offering subsidies or grants. Such initiatives could help decrease the financial limitations that service providers face when considering investments in underserved areas. Collaborative efforts between local governments and personal entities can foster a more favorable environment for the expansion of IoT technologies.

Additionally, the implementation of alternative connectivity options can bridge gaps. Technologies like satellite internet, mesh networks, and low-power wide-area networks (LPWAN) have emerged as possible options for enhancing IoT connectivity in rural settings. These options can complement conventional broadband avenues and supply much-needed protection to make certain that rural communities can fully profit from IoT functions.


In agriculture, for instance, farmers in distant areas can harness IoT technologies to observe crop health, soil moisture, and weather situations. These applications can lead to knowledgeable decision-making that increases yield efficiency. However, without dependable connectivity, the total potential of such tools remains untapped, limiting agricultural developments and rural financial growth.


Healthcare can also benefit from IoT solutions, particularly in isolated regions. Telehealth services can provide critical care to sufferers without the necessity for long-distance journey. However, challenges related to connectivity can undermine these healthcare solutions, making them less accessible for rural populations. The need for dependable information transmission is vital in emergencies, where every second counts.

Yes, technologies like LoRaWAN and Sigfox are designed for long-range communication with low energy consumption, making them efficient for rural IoT deployment where traditional cellular or Wi-Fi networks may be unreliable.
